Package: memtest86+
Version: 4.20-1
Followup-For: Bug #629506

I can confirm this behavior. Memtest86+ (the standard option) flickers and the 
computer resets, as described. Memtest86+ (multiboot) hangs showing only the 
GRUB background image.

Software:
Debian Wheezy, Linux 3.0.0-1-amd64, GRUB 2 (PC BIOS. I think EFI did the same 
thing.)

Hardware:
Intel Core i7 2600K
Asus P8P67 Deluxe (rev 3)
G.skill F3-10666C7Q-16GBXH
